Position Description:

The Spray Technician will perform all of the necessary chemical applications to all landscape areas. This is an hourly position working 35+ hours during a regular work week schedule (Monday-Friday and weekends as necessary). The purpose of this position is to identify all needs for chemical control in the landscape and make the correct appropriate application of chemicals.

Responsibilities:
  • Identification - Includes recognizing insects and insect damage, fungus and fungus damage, broadleaf and grassy weeds, all types of turf, shrubs and trees.
  • Mixing - Includes identifying the appropriate chemical(s) to use and mixing the correct amount for the application while minimizing waste.
  • Application - Includes have a properly calibrated sprayer to apply the mixed chemical at the appropriate rate to treat the identified issues.
  • Application Logs - Fill out daily chemical application log and turn in at end of shift.
  • Performing General Physical Activities - Performing physical activities that require considerable use of your arms and legs and moving your whole body, such as climbing, lifting, balancing, walking, stooping, digging holes and handling of materials during extreme weather for 8+ hours daily.
  • Operating Vehicles, Mechanized Devices, or Equipment - Running, maneuvering, navigating, or driving vehicles or mechanized equipment, such as trucks, trucks with trailers, 2-cycle power equipment, lawn mowers, bobcats, ATV, golf cart or mobile sprayer.


Qualifications:
  • Valid Driver's License
  • Ability to perform basic math (Multiplication, division, subtraction, addition)
  • Previous commercial chemical application experience
